Expand your Torque Pro capabilities by adding this plugin to monitor specific HYUNDAI vehicle parameters.
Monitor specific HYUNDAI parameters in real-time, including detailed engine and automatic transmission sensor data, by integrating this plugin with Torque Pro.
Advanced LT is a plugin for Torque Pro that extends the PID/Sensor list with HYUNDAI-specific parameters. Try the plugin with limited sensors before purchasing. This version does not include calculated sensors such as Injector Duty Cycle (%) or HIVEC mode.

The plugin also includes an ECU Scanner, which is useful for finding specific sensors on HYUNDAI engines not yet supported. Simply record at least 1000 samples and send the logs to the developer.
Advanced LT requires the latest version of Torque Pro to function. This is *NOT* a standalone application and will *NOT* work without Torque Pro.
Plugin Installation
-------------------------
1) After downloading the plugin from Google Play, verify it appears in your Android device's installed applications list.
2) Launch Torque Pro and tap the "Advanced LT" icon.
3) Select the appropriate engine type and return to the Torque Pro main screen.
4) Navigate to Torque Pro "Settings".
5) Confirm the plugin is listed in Torque Pro by going to "Settings" > "Plugins" > "Installed Plugins".
6) Scroll down to "Manage extra PIDs/Sensors".
7) This screen typically displays no entries unless you have added pre-defined or custom PIDs previously.
8) From the menu, select "Add predefined set".
9) You may see predefined sets for other HYUNDAI engine types—ensure you select the correct one.
10) After selecting the entry, additional items should appear in the Extra PIDs/Sensors list.
Adding Displays
------------------------
1) Once you have added the extra sensors, go to the Realtime Information/Dashboard.
2) Press the menu key and select "Add Display".
3) Choose the desired display type (Dial, Bar, Graph, Digital Display, etc.).
4) Select the corresponding sensor from the list. Sensors from Advanced LT start with "[HADV]" and are listed near the top, right after time sensors.
